TICKET-4182: Canary gate vault locked after failed rotation. The Brightquill deploy pipeline halted because the canary gating rules live in the Fernlock vault, which auto-locked after three bad unseal attempts. Until unlocked, no canary promotions to prod can pass the 5% traffic gate. Raising for the weekly sync so Priya's team can schedule the unseal. Recovery requires the passphrase below.

vault phrase of tawig-taduf = zorath-oliwyn

Visiting contractors at Bramleigh Systems may need occasional access to the spare-hardware storage room on Level 2, beside the print hub. The room holds replacement monitors, cables, and docking stations for short-term loan. Please sign the equipment log on the shelf by the door and note anything you remove. Access is granted only during escorted visits unless your engagement lasts longer than a week. The door requires the current pass code, which is listed below.

turnstile pass: bdg-NZJSS-18109

## Local Setup

Reproducing the Wrenfeed websocket reconnect bug: run `wren dev --flaky` to inject periodic disconnects. Watch for duplicate subscription rows after the third reconnect — that's the bug. Client retries are exponential, capped at 60s. Session state is persisted between reconnects; inspect it in the sessions database via the connection string below.

primary connection of yagep-kahip = redis://giliel_svc:zYiKsLL2PLpfPL@db-348f.xolmarsys.corp:5432/fenwyn

☐ Key ceremony step 4 — Sketchline diagram editor. Verify undo/redo history is flushed before sealing the signing vault. Open any diagram, perform three edits, undo all, redo all, confirm no orphaned state in the audit log. Contractors: do not skip the redo pass. Once verified, unseal using the passphrase printed below.

vault phrase of hahop-badug = novvan-ulaion-zorius-noviel-gorwyn-casix-tamys

The Mapleford Clinic reminder job has been silently skipping sends since Tuesday. Turns out the staging env file got copied to prod during the Bellhaven migration, so the job is pointing at the sandbox messaging gateway, which just swallows everything. I've fixed the gateway URL and the cron schedule already — diff attached for review. One thing I can't commit: the prod gateway credential has to be added by hand. Once you approve, append it directly under the gateway URL line.

vault entry, yajop-fajof: VAULT_KEY8=82c6da7e